A baseball travels 150 km/h. What does this measurement represent?
a. time
b. speed
c. position
d. distance

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 04-06-2016
The best answer to the question that is being presented above would be the speed. Since speed is characterized by distance/time, the 150 km/h is one example of a measurement of speed. Thus, the correct answer should be letter b. which is speed.
